The Mechanicsville Public Library offers a variety of programs and resources tailored to the needs of homeschoolers and the general public alike. It provides educational materials and activities that cater to all age groups, with a specific emphasis on early learning through its engaging workshops and craft sessions. Notably, the library facilitates a community-centric environment where families can access reading materials, participate in educational programs, and explore thematic learning activities designed to supplement homeschool education. Their programs, inclusive of both in-person and digital resources, are invaluable for curious minds looking to expand their learning horizon.
